Um... as far as I know there isn't one on the Ralliart. The top speed is limited by the gearing of the transmission. Once you hit redline in top gear you can't go any faster.
You don't, without replacing the ECU and going full standalone. I can't fathom any reason why you'd need to, anyways. Even on a standing mile course, our car wouldn't be able to hit its top speed, unless you were turbocharged.
Some of the ralliart ECU's I've looked at do have a speed governor on them. Can't remember which model year and market. When I reflash them it's easy to change the rev limit and/or governor. The motor will rev to 7250 but I can hear the valves starting to float so I usually go only as high as 7000.
